9 History

In Year 9 History, students explore the Industrial Revolution with a focus on child labour before moving onto the reasons for early settlement in Australia, the Indigenous perspective on settlement, and how the discovery of gold impacted on the colonies.  The causes of World War One and the impact of the war on the newly federated nation of Australia will also be also examined. Students will further hone their analysis of primary and secondary sources through interrogating their reliability and bias. Students continued to develop their oral presentation and essay writing skills.
